Gallic adj. Pertaining to, or derived from, galls, nutgalls, and the like.
Gallic acid (Chem.), an organic acid, very widely distributed in the vegetable kingdom, being found in the free state in galls, tea, etc., and produced artificially. It is a white, crystalline substance, C6H2(HO)3.CO2H, with an astringent taste, and is a strong reducing agent, as employed in photography. It is usually prepared from tannin, and both give a dark color with iron salts, forming tannate and gallate of iron, which are the essential ingredients of common black ink.

The excess of nitrate of silver and the heavy yellow powder which forms are now washed off, and the paper is ready for the camera. The picture may be developed by a solution of gallic acid mixed with a very small quantity of an aqueous solution of acetic acid and nitrate of silver. The picture is fixed by washing with hyposulphite of soda.
